Role Description The Health and Safety Coordinator is a full-time, on-site role based in the Greater Toronto Area, Canada. This role is responsible for supporting, implementing, and monitoring health and safety programs across construction sites and operations. Day-to-day tasks include conducting site inspections, identifying hazards, and ensuring compliance with company policies and relevant legislation. The coordinator will develop and deliver safety training, maintain safety documentation and incident reports, and assist with investigations and corrective actions. The role also involves collaborating with project managers, supervisors, and crews to promote a safety-focused culture and continuous improvement in health and safety performance.
